Prudential Financial Inc. lifted its holdings in shares of Qfin Holdings Inc. - Sponsored ADR (NASDAQ:QFIN - Free Report) by 107.7% in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 238,368 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 123,600 shares during the quarter. Prudential Financial Inc. owned approximately 0.15% of Qfin worth $10,336,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

Several equities research analysts have commented on the company. JPMorgan Chase & Co. lowered Qfin from an "overweight" rating to a "neutral" rating and cut their price objective for the stock from $45.00 to $21.00 in a research note on Wednesday, November 19th. Weiss Ratings lowered Qfin from a "buy (b-)" rating to a "hold (c+)" rating in a research note on Saturday, October 25th. Zacks Research upgraded Qfin from a "strong sell" rating to a "hold" rating in a research report on Tuesday, November 18th. Finally, Wall Street Zen downgraded Qfin from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ating in a research note on Friday, August 22nd. One analyst has rated the stock with a Buy rating and three have assigned a Hold rating to the company's stock. According to MarketBeat.com, Qfin presently has an average rating of "Hold" and an average target price of $36.85.

Qfin Price Performance

QFIN stock opened at $19.73 on Friday. Qfin Holdings Inc. - Sponsored ADR has a 1 year low of $17.61 and a 1 year high of $48.94.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.20, a current ratio of 2.94 and a quick ratio of 2.94. The firm has a market capitalization of $2.80 billion, a PE ratio of 2.88,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.21 and a beta of 0.39. The business has a 50 day simple moving average of $25.07 and a 200-day simple moving average of $33.42.

Qfin (NASDAQ:QFIN -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, November 18th. The company reported $1.52 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$1.68 by ($0.16). Qfin had a return on equity of 28.73% and a net margin of 35.09%.The company had revenue of $731.04 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$693.21 million. Equities research analysts anticipate that Qfin Holdings Inc. - Sponsored ADR will post 5.71 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Qifu Technology, Inc, through its subsidiaries, operates credit-tech platform under the 360 Jietiao brand in the People's Republic of China. It provides credit-driven services that matches borrowers with financial institutions to conduct customer acquisition, initial and credit screening, advanced risk assessment, credit assessment, fund matching, and other post-facilitation services; and platform services, including loan facilitation and post-facilitation services to financial institution partners under intelligence credit engine, referral services, and risk management software-as-a-service.
